QUOTE(scotty @ Jun 9 2007, 09:15 AM)
even canon 350d,400d,30d ,5d internal flash can be use to trigger sb800. and the list continue. means whatever with flash can trigger sb800 smile.gif
*
thats in SU-4 mode, which is really a manual slave and is not CLS. With CLS, the flash output is metered via TTL despite being off camera...
